An elderly couple died in a single-vehicle crash Sunday afternoon in the South Side Hyde Park neighborhood.

Wilbon B. McClerkin, 73, was driving a car westbound in the 1700 block of East 57th Drive at 2:23 p.m. when it left the road and crashed into a tree, according to police and the Cook County medical examiner’s office.

His wife, 72-year-old Winnie Maecole -McClerkin, was sitting in the passenger seat at the time of the crash, authorities said.

The McClerkins, of the 8400 block of South Marquette Avenue, were both pronounced dead at the scene, authorities said. Autopsies were scheduled for Monday.

The police Major Accidents Unit is investigating.
